Money Court is a reality TV series that premiered in 2021 and is set to air until 2023. The show is hosted by Kevin O'Leary, a Canadian businessman and entrepreneur best known for his role on the hit TV show Shark Tank. Joining him as regular judges are Bethenny Frankel, a successful businesswoman and founder of Skinnygirl, and Katie Phang, a respected attorney and legal analyst.

The show revolves around small-claims court cases involving financial disputes, with the litigants seeking a resolution and compensation for their grievances. The cases range from landlord-tenant disputes, debt repayment issues, contract disputes and more. The show also provides a unique insight into the US legal system and how it functions when dealing with small financial disputes.

Each episode of Money Court features two different cases, with each one being presented by a different litigant. The cases are selected based on their uniqueness and the impact that a resolution could have on the parties involved. The litigants are given the opportunity to present their case and answer the judges' questions. They also provide supporting evidence such as documentation, photographs, and witnesses to bolster their argument.
